How Do Wigs Help Cancer Patients

by Lisa / Thursday, 16 March 2023 / Published in Hair FAQs
130% Density Human Hair Lace Front Wigs #613 Body Wave (1)

Cancer patients often face numerous challenges during their treatment journey, with hair loss being one of the most visible and emotionally impactful side effects of chemotherapy and other cancer therapies. While the primary concern is always the treatment and recovery from cancer, the psychological and social consequences of hair loss cannot be ignored. Wigs have emerged as a practical and empowering solution, offering both aesthetic and emotional benefits to individuals undergoing this difficult experience. Below, we explore in detail how wigs help cancer patients cope and regain a sense of normalcy.

1. Restoring a Sense of Identity and Confidence

Hair is often closely tied to one’s identity and self-expression. Losing it can feel like losing a part of oneself, leading to a significant blow to self-esteem. For cancer patients, wearing a wig can help restore their sense of identity, allowing them to look in the mirror and recognize themselves again. This renewed sense of self can significantly improve mental well-being, helping patients feel more like themselves as they navigate their treatment.

2. Maintaining Privacy During Treatment

Hair loss is often a visible sign of undergoing cancer treatment, which can lead to unwanted attention or questions from others. For many patients, the constant reminders of their condition can be emotionally exhausting. Wigs act as a form of camouflage, helping individuals maintain their privacy and discretion. By wearing a wig, patients can go about their daily lives without having to explain or discuss their health unless they choose to.

3. Providing Comfort and Practicality

Wigs are not only about aesthetics; they also serve practical purposes. Chemotherapy-induced hair loss can leave the scalp feeling sensitive and exposed to environmental factors like sunlight or cold weather. High-quality wigs, particularly those made with soft and breathable materials, offer protection from these elements while also improving comfort.

4. Enabling Social Integration and Normalcy

Hair loss can act as a constant reminder of illness, not just for the patient but also for the people around them. This visible change can sometimes create awkwardness in social scenarios, as friends, family, and colleagues may not know how to respond. Wigs allow cancer patients to integrate more seamlessly into social settings, helping them feel “normal” and reducing the impact of their condition on their personal and professional lives.

For children and teenagers battling cancer, wigs can be particularly helpful in mitigating feelings of being “different.” School, social events, and extracurricular activities become less daunting experiences when they feel confident in their appearance.

5. Supporting Mental and Emotional Health

The psychological effects of hair loss are profound and can contribute to feelings of sadness, anxiety, or even depression. Wigs can act as an emotional support tool by giving cancer patients a way to take control of their appearance, which in turn can boost their overall outlook on life. The simple act of styling and wearing a wig can be therapeutic, offering a sense of routine and normalcy amidst the chaos of cancer treatments.

A study shows that cancer patients who use wigs often report higher levels of self-esteem and improved mental health compared to those who choose not to use wigs. By alleviating some of the emotional burden associated with hair loss, wigs can complement the broader treatment plan and support holistic recovery.

7. Offering Tailored Solutions for Diverse Needs

Every cancer patient has unique needs and preferences when it comes to wigs. While some may prefer synthetic wigs for their affordability and ease of maintenance, others might opt for natural human hair wigs for their realistic appearance and texture. The following table outlines the key differences between synthetic and natural hair wigs to help patients make an informed choice:

Feature Synthetic Wigs Natural Hair Wigs
Appearance Realistic but less natural Completely natural
Maintenance Low maintenance Requires regular care
Durability Shorter lifespan Long-lasting with care
Cost More affordable Higher cost
Styling Flexibility Limited (pre-styled) Can be heat-styled

8. Building a Supportive Community

The process of selecting and wearing wigs often introduces cancer patients to a network of support from wig specialists, fellow patients, and even online forums. These connections can be incredibly empowering, reminding patients that they are not alone in their journey. Sharing tips, experiences, and encouragement can make the wig-wearing experience more positive and fulfilling.
